Scope & Segmentation of the Collision Avoidance Systems Market
This report delivers actionable insights into the primary segments that are shaping the collision avoidance systems market, empowering senior leaders to refine approaches to regulatory change, technology deployment, and operational adaptation across multiple sectors.
- Applications: Addresses use cases in automotive, aerospace and defense, marine, and rail, each requiring tailored safety protocols and connectivity features to ensure compliance and operational reliability.
- Technologies: Includes multi-format cameras, radar, LiDAR, ultrasonic sensors, and approaches like sensor fusion, all supporting in-depth risk assessment and improved real-time safety management.
- Vehicle Types: Encompasses commercial vehicles, passenger cars, and two-wheelers, allowing firms to implement customized safety measures and scale deployments as business needs evolve.
- Automation Levels: Ranges from basic driver assistance tools to advanced automation, enabling immediate regulatory compliance and future readiness for autonomous operations.
- Distribution Channels: Covers OEM integration and aftermarket retrofits, facilitating seamless upgrades and supporting flexible technology investment for both new and legacy fleets.
- Regional Coverage: Analyzes market dynamics in the Americas, EMEA, and Asia-Pacific, highlighting region-specific regulatory requirements and infrastructure development that inform local decision-making.

Tariff Impact: Adapting to Evolving Global Supply Chains
Current changes in U.S. tariffs are prompting collision avoidance systems providers to reconsider sourcing and manufacturing models. With component costs rising, companies are pursuing nearshoring, expanding supplier bases, and increasing local assembly and quality controls. These adaptations build more robust supply chains and position enterprises to respond quickly to evolving trade policies.
